Key Responsibilities

  • Commercial Property Work & Client Advisory: Managing your own caseload across a broad range of commercial property matters, including buying, selling, and leasing commercial property. Advising clients on landlord and tenant matters and a wide variety of commercial property agreements, including technically demanding documentation. Providing clear, practical, and commercially focused advice using plain English.
  • Client Relationship Management: Acting for a broad range of commercial clients and developing strong, long‑term client relationships. Demonstrating a commercially aware, client‑first approach in all aspects of your work.
  • Business Development & Profile Building: Supporting the firm’s marketing and business development activities as appropriate, including networking and relationship building. Contributing to the continued growth and profile of the Commercial Property department.
  • Teamwork & Professional Development: Working collaboratively as part of a supportive and enthusiastic team. Continuing to develop your technical skills, commercial awareness, and professional confidence through internal and external training.

The Ideal Candidate

  • Circa 2+ years’ PQE as a Commercial Property Solicitor or Chartered Legal Executive with practice rights.
  • Proven experience across all aspects of commercial property law, including buying, selling, and leasing.
  • A solid working knowledge of property law and landlord and tenant law.
  • A track record of building and maintaining strong client relationships.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with a commitment to clear, plain‑English advice.
  • Strong organisational, interpersonal, and IT skills.
  • An enthusiastic, team‑focused approach with a good balance of technical ability and commercial awareness.
